It’s a simple dish to add to any meal or, for that matter, can be an appetizing lunch with a bit of garlic bread or just plain Italian bread to dunk in the juice.
This time, though, I was without cucumbers at the ready since the veggies at the local market, especially the cokes, looked terrible. When I say awful, they mainly were squishy and soft to the touch, with many having thumbprints where others were testing them.
So, we decided to adjust this traditional tomato and cucumber salad.
We added chopped celery and roasted peppers. You could also add onions, but that’s up to you.
What You Need:
Balsamic or Red Wine Vinegar: Whichever tempts your taste buds san as much as you feel is correct
Extra Virgin Olive Oil: Same with the olive oil. The amount is totally up to your taste buds and the brand is your decision.
Main Stuff:
Celery
Tomatoes: Whichever kind you have on hand
Pepper: Sweet or Hot, your choice
Pick a Veggie You Love and add it
Spices:
Salt: to taste
Pepper: same
Basil: same
Oregano: same
Fresh Garlic: 1-2 clovis diced or chopped
Garlic Powder: when garlic isn’t around: Amount: same as above
Onions (a few slices or diced up, your preference or use Onion Powder: again up to your tasted.
Etc.
A little Italian parsley is a nice touch, but not needed
